Output 64ba5a13868e0b9fcc2acb0afe2fea55286eb04b4a8727ee2e7ad981657ef8c1:0

value
355800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b296b978e24e09486abd3e60a4c8a76a6ceb8a73 OP_EQUAL
address
3HyJmDDfoWf6VAhRG7zWAgFUWAHgs38jVr
transaction
64ba5a13868e0b9fcc2acb0afe2fea55286eb04b4a8727ee2e7ad981657ef8c1